Transaction 366dedffdf7a0b05af6272dd62e87e1dd467c987f36b4ac4c22afcec9779ab0e
1 Input
2 Outputs
- 366dedffdf7a0b05af6272dd62e87e1dd467c987f36b4ac4c22afcec9779ab0e:0
- 366dedffdf7a0b05af6272dd62e87e1dd467c987f36b4ac4c22afcec9779ab0e:1
value 15257202
address 3PL3DzvqMFWkeVJuYQDQCxkoAuFQeNiFep
value 3314068
address 16M65QXqgrKybZynTjpWcV3dDKFPTMzjty